7 Steps to Good Quality Website Design

What is quality website design? Before visual aesthetics, studies have shown that usability and utility are the most important aspects of website design that will determine a site’s longevity and popularity. After all, if a user can’t figure out how to get around your site or what it’s about, what’s the use? The following are some tips on how to construct effective, user-friendly web pages.

Step #1: Simplicity Comes First

It is of utmost importance that the navigation of your website is completely self-explanatory. In website design, your job is to reduce the amount of ambiguity in your web pages. Remove any misleading links, and keep all texts clear and succinct. A user should not have to spend time figuring out what a web page is about, or have to guess how to get from point A to B.

Step #2: Don’t Make Life Difficult

There’s nothing people hate more than filling out forms. The less the requirements for the user, the more likely he or she will take a minute to try out what you have to offer. Another useful technique in website design is to ask for personal information after the user has been given a chance to sample a particular product or service.

Step #3: Focus the User’s Attention

Focus attention to certain parts of your web page with the use of visual elements. Try to focus on the bigger picture first, such as what the web page is about, and focus on smaller details less. If you are using images, try to use images that are related or relevant to the theme of the web page. Users should understand immediately what you are trying to communicate with your images.

Step #4: Guide New Users Step by Step

Many web designers have experienced success with step-by-step type setups. These usually include large buttons that guide the user through the website without having to think. Utilizing this type of website design allows the user to comfortably navigate your site and sample all the major features and functions.

Step #5: Keep your Writing Simple

Studies have shown that a user’s attention span when browsing the net is very short. Usually, promotional writing is ignored, and long text blocks with no pictures or bold or italicized words are skipped. Good website design dictates that sentences should be short and concise, organized or bulleted, and written in conversational and objective language.

Step #6: Stick to Conventional Website Design

In the case of website, doing what everyone else does is not boring and uncreative, but efficient. Using conventional formats and naming links with conventional words or phrases greatly reduces the user’s learning curve.

Step #7: Test Early and Often

Statistics show that most mistakes in website design are not done in the implementation phase of a project, but in the design and planning phase. Typically, errors in the fundamental design of a website snowballs into bigger problems later. Therefore, it is crucial that you work all the major kinks in your design early in the game, and do it at regular intervals.

Effective website design will make browsing your web pages much more comfortable and enjoyable for users. Always remember to keep things simple and to the point. Following these 7 simple steps for effective website design will help you to create a clearer, easier to understand, and easier to navigate website.
